You can spend time browsing the exhibits at Foley Railroad Museum in Foley. Experience the great live music or attend a sporting event in this family-friendly area.
Stroll the charming streets of city centre where local shops and seafood restaurants welcome visitors in flip-flops and sundresses. The white sand beaches and OWA amusement park offer perfect day trips, while nearby Gulf State Park's trails reveal coastal wildlife at dawn.

From Foley to the beach is a tourist area and traffic is heavy. If that's an issue you should pay more to be at the beach or stay further North to avoid the vacationers.

The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 27°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 14°C. Average annual precipitation for Foley is 1555 mm.
